Playing a prospect in majors instead of minors

I have a question. If i have a hot shot prospect but he isnt fully developed (say a 5 rating in hitting average, but has a brilliant talent in this category) Would it hurt his developement progress by me putting him in the majors (given a full time starting oppurtunity)? Lets also say the hitting coach's rating is brilliant and the AAA minors coach's developement rating is a brilliant also. Anybody that knows something about this please help, any help will be greatly appreciated.

In your example, he is ready to come up to the bigs. Usually for me. Once my prospects get to be about 4-5 rated and I have a need for them I call them up.

Take in mind though that not every player develops at the same pace. He may take 2 years to reach his full potential. He may blossom in the next month in your league. And he may never develop to his full potential.

To answer your question, in my experience he will not be hurt by bringing him up. Just be patient.

I agree with holycow. He could probly hold his own against ML pitching, and it wouldnt stunt his growth. If it was me though i'de try and keep him down until he was a 7 or 8, unless I really needed him. THat way you dont waste a year or 2 off his contract.
